The Solid Edge Student Edition is a free version of Siemens’ professional 3D CAD software. It is specifically tailored for academic use, allowing students to learn the same tools used by industry professionals at top engineering firms.
While the software is free, it is intended for educational purposes only. Files created in the Student Edition are watermarked and cannot be opened in commercial versions of Solid Edge to prevent unauthorized business use. Why Choose Solid Edge ST10?
Solid Edge ST10 was a milestone release for Siemens. Even as newer versions come out, ST10 is often sought after for its stability and specific feature set:
Synchronous Technology: Combines the speed of direct modeling with the control of parametric design.
Generative Design: Built-in topology optimization to create lighter, stronger parts.
Convergent Modeling: Allows you to work seamlessly with mesh data (STL files) alongside traditional b-rep geometry.
Reverse Engineering: Improved tools for cleaning up and editing scanned 3D data. How to Download Solid Edge Student Edition

Activation: The Student Edition usually comes with a pre-embedded license or a code that activates the software for academic use for one year (renewable as long as you are a student). System Requirements for ST10
Before downloading, ensure your laptop or desktop meets the minimum specifications to avoid crashes: Operating System: Windows 7, 8, or 10 (64-bit only). RAM: 8 GB minimum (16 GB recommended). Hard Disk Space: At least 6.5 GB for installation.
Graphics Card: A professional-grade card (NVIDIA Quadro or AMD FirePro) is ideal, though many modern integrated chips can handle basic student projects. Tips for Getting Started

The Legacy of Solid Edge St10 Released in 2017, Solid Edge St10 marked a pivotal moment in the software’s history. The "St" stands for Synchronous Technology, a proprietary innovation by Siemens that allows users to edit 3D models without the historical "design tree" constraints found in traditional parametric CAD systems. St10 introduced robust enhancements in areas such as generative design, additive manufacturing (3D printing), and converged modeling. For a student, St10 represents a stable, mature iteration of the software that encompasses all the fundamental tools required for mechanical design—part modeling, assembly creation, and 2D drafting—while introducing advanced concepts like topology optimization. Mastering this version ensures that students are not only learning how to draw shapes but are also understanding the logic of modern design optimization.

Key Features and Performance Synchronous Technology
: This remains the standout feature. It allows you to edit geometry directly without worrying about the order in which features were created, combining the speed of direct modeling with the control of parametric design. Convergent Modeling
: ST10 introduced the ability to work seamlessly with "faceted" data (like STL files from 3D scans) alongside traditional B-Rep solid geometry. This is a massive time-saver for reverse engineering. Generative Design
: It includes integrated topology optimization, helping students design lighter, stronger parts by letting the software calculate the most efficient material distribution based on applied loads. Built-in Data Management
: For student projects involving large assemblies, the basic revision and status tracking tools help keep complex files organized without needing a full PLM system. Pros and Cons Completely Free
